Event - "Roller Station"
From Friday 2 December 2022 to Sunday 26 February 2023, Port Hercule de Monaco
In line with the measures adopted by the Prince's Government to encourage energy saving, including the removal of the ice skating rink, the Municipal Council is keen to propose an alternative solution to keep the young and the not-so-young amused this winter. The Roller Station will take up residence at the Stade Nautique Rainier III, in the location usually occupied by the swimming pool, and will replace the ice rink! For those without their own equipment, roller skates will be available for visitors.

Philosophy Debates - "Masculine, feminine, neuter, etc."
Thursday 19 January 2023, from 7 pm to 9 pm, Théâtre Princesse Grace
The concept of gender, formed against the backdrop of philosophy, human and social sciences, refers to the numerous models according to which differences between the sexes take their meaning and structure the way society is organised. As such, it has become a category of analysis and interpretation of the exclusively social conformation of masculine and feminine roles, understood as complex sets with differences of class, sexual orientation, culture, ethnicity, and religion. But the concept of gender has ultimately generated a myriad of interpretations, questions, and controversies, leading to the emergence of increasingly diverse "genders" (LGTBQIA+, cis, non-binary, agender or neutral, omnigender, intersex, pan-gender, gender-fluid, etc.). How are we to understand it today, if we are to save the processes of subjectivation, and if, despite the controversies, we want the concept to retain its heuristic qualities of inventiveness and discovery - tracing and tracking all forms of domination?
